Warning Signs You Need Structural Repair After Water Damage

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ards. Catch these signs early to prevent bigger problems down the road.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show hidden water damage.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s time to investigate.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Discoloration on ceilings or walls can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ore these stains, they can lead to further damage and safety hazards.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ause flooring to warp or buckle. If you notice these signs,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Cracked or Separated Walls

Cracks or separation in walls can show structural damage. Don’t delay, this can lead to further damage and safety hazards.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ks in your property can be a sign of structural damage. If you notice these signs, it’s time to investigate.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age, such as water pooling or standing water, is a clear sign that you need immediate attention.

Structural Repair After Water Damage Cost In Palisades Park, NJ

The cost of Structural Repair After Water Damage can vary widely, dep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Palisades Park, NJ. These are estimates, not guarantees, and the actual cost may be higher or lower. Our team will provide you with a detailed estimate and timeline for the repair process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Planning $500 – $2,000 The extent of the damage and the complexity of the repair
Demolition and Cleanup $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of debris
Structural Repair $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the structural damage and the materials required
Reconstruction and Finishing $3,000 – $15,000 The scope of the reconstruction and the materials required
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$500 – $2,000 The extent of the work required to ensure the property meets our high standards
More Services (e.g., mold remediation, drywall repair) $500 – $5,000 The scope and complexity of the more services required
